Definity Financial (TSE:DFY – Get Rating) had its price objective lifted by stock analysts at Cormark from C$36.00 to C$39.00 in a report released on Thursday, MarketBeat.com reports. The brokerage currently has a “buy” rating on the stock. Cormark’s target price would suggest a potential downside of 0.20% from the stock’s current price. Cormark also issued estimates for Definity Financial’s Q3 2022 earnings at $0.44 EPS, Q4 2022 earnings at $0.45 EPS, FY2022 earnings at $1.86 EPS, Q1 2023 earnings at $0.62 EPS, Q2 2023 earnings at $0.49 EPS, Q3 2023 earnings at $0.46 EPS, Q4 2023 earnings at $0.42 EPS and FY2023 earnings at $2.16 EPS.
Other equities research analysts also recently issued research reports about the company. Raymond James downgraded Definity Financial from an “outperform” rating to a “market perform” rating and increased their price objective for the company from C$34.50 to C$36.00 in a research report on Wednesday. TD Securities increased their price objective on Definity Financial from C$39.00 to C$41.00 and gave the company a “buy” rating in a research report on Wednesday. Haywood Securities cut their price objective on Definity Financial to C$39.50 and set an “outperform” rating for the company in a research report on Friday, July 22nd. Royal Bank of Canada increased their price objective on Definity Financial from C$40.00 to C$43.00 and gave the company an “outperform” rating in a research report on Wednesday. Finally, Barclays increased their price objective on Definity Financial from C$37.00 to C$38.00 and gave the company a “na” rating in a research report on Tuesday, July 26th. One analyst has rated the stock with a hold rating and seven have given a buy rating to the company’s stock. According to data from MarketBeat.com, Definity Financial presently has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us price target of C$39.60.
Definity Financial Stock Up 2.7 %
Shares of Definity Financial stock opened at C$39.08 on Thursday. The company has a current ratio of 0.34, a quick ratio of 0.28 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.75. The business’s 50 day simple moving average is C$34.27 and its 200-day simple moving average is C$31.94. The stock has a market capitalization of C$4.53 billion and a price-to-earnings ratio of 24.84. Definity Financial has a twelve month low of C$26.00 and a twelve month high of C$39.43.
Definity Financial Company Profile
Definity Financial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ides property and casualty insurance products in Canada. It offers personal insurance products, including auto, property, general and umbrella liability, and pet insurance products to individuals under the Economical, Sonnet, Family, Petsecure, and Peppermint brands; and commercial insurance products comprising fleet, commercial auto, property, liability, and specialty insurance products to businesses under the under the Economical brand name.
